What is the job description of a staging rigging company ETCP rigger?

An ETCP rigger working for a staging rigging company is responsible for installing, inspecting, and maintaining rigging systems used in entertainment and event production. They ensure safety standards are met, operate rigging tools and equipment, and often hold ETCP certification to demonstrate expertise in rigging safety and procedures. The role requires knowledge of load calculations, safety protocols, and working at heights in a dynamic environment.

ETCP Riggers are specialized professionals trained in rigging safety and load management, often holding certifications like ETCP. Stagehands perform general setup and support tasks but typically do not have advanced rigging certifications. While both roles work in live event environments, ETCP Riggers focus on complex rigging tasks, ensuring safety and compliance, whereas Stagehands handle more general labor tasks.

District Overview

Established in 1919, Weeks Marine, Inc. is one of the largest marine, dredging and tunneling contractors in North America and has successfully completed projects throughout North and South America, from inland waterways to offshore sites in the Pacific and the Atlantic. Weeks Marine has three key divisions - Construction, Dredging and Marine Services - which are bolstered by three major subsidiaries, Healy Tibbitts Builders, Inc., McNally International, Inc. and North American Aggregates.

Weeks Marine's vast reach and deep expertise, combined with the sheer size and diversity of its equipment fleet, enables the company to serve as a one-stop shop for clients in both the private and governmental sectors, providing exceptional customer service, environmental sensitivity, operational efficiency, and a long-standing commitment to safety. Weeks Marine is headquartered in Cranford, New Jersey, and manages a network of regional offices in Louisiana, Texas, Hawaii, Guam, Ontario, and Nova Scotia.
